Core Banking Systems Reviews and Ratings
What are Core Banking Systems?
Gartner defines a core banking system (CBS) as the financial institution’s back‐office software that performs real-time or end-of-day processing for deposits and loans. Apart from advancing the processing dates, representative capabilities include transaction posting, interest accrual/payment, service charge calculation and cash management (zero balance, target balance). CBSs provide deposit and loan product servicing with interfaces to other applications, such as customer-facing channels, general ledger systems and reporting tools. CBSs can be deployed on the bank’s premises or run from the cloud or any hosted environment. Bank employees and customers either directly or indirectly use the bank’s CBS.
The CBSs of a financial institution’s back‐office software perform either real-time or end-of-day processing for deposits and loans. Apart from advancing the processing dates, representative capabilities include transaction posting, interest accrual and posting, service charge calculation and cash management (zero balance, target balance). All these processes and steps imply a business model based on conventional banking principles that imply interest accrual on accounts and profitability from any lending practice. Therefore, CBSs, by definition, implicitly exclude Islamic CBSs that, to the contrary, use Islamic financial tools to back Shariah-compliant business models that require different mechanisms to produce profits.
Product Listings
Filter by
Temenos Core Banking is a software designed to support banks in managing their core banking operations including account management, deposits, loans, payments, and treasury. The software provides process automation and enables integration with digital channels and third-party systems. It offers real-time data processing, customizable workflows, and support for multi-currency and multi-entity structures. Businesses use the software to centralize data management, streamline transaction processing, enhance regulatory compliance, and improve operational efficiency across retail, corporate, and private banking sectors. The software addresses business problems related to legacy system limitations, process inefficiencies, and the need for rapid product innovation.
Finacle Core Banking Solution is a software designed to support banking operations by automating and managing key banking processes including account management, deposits, loans, payments, and customer information. The software offers modules for retail, corporate, and universal banking and includes features for regulatory compliance, risk management, and reporting. It enables banks to streamline transactions, improve operational efficiency, and support integration with digital channels and third-party systems. The software provides tools for product configuration, process automation, and real-time transaction processing to address the needs of modern banking environments.
FLEXCUBE is a banking software that assists financial institutions in managing core banking operations including retail, corporate, and investment banking. The software provides modules for deposits, loans, payments, treasury, trade finance, and risk management. It enables banks to automate and streamline business processes, supports regulatory compliance, and facilitates integration with various channels and ecosystems. FLEXCUBE allows institutions to manage customer data, product information, transactions, and reporting across multiple currencies and languages. The software is designed to address challenges related to operational efficiency, transaction processing, product innovation, and customer service in the banking sector.
TCS BaNCS is a software that provides solutions for core banking, payments, wealth management, insurance, and capital markets. The software supports digital transformation for financial institutions by streamlining operations, enabling real-time transactions, enhancing automation, and supporting compliance with regulatory requirements. TCS BaNCS facilitates integration with multiple channels and ecosystems, allowing financial organizations to deliver efficient services and adapt to evolving market demands. The software addresses business challenges such as legacy system modernization, operational efficiency, and improved customer experience by offering modular platforms and scalable architecture that can be customized to fit distinct business needs within the financial sector.
Azentio iMAL Islamic banking is an AAOIFI-certified, Shari’ah-compliant core banking platform designed to support Islamic retail, corporate, treasury, trade finance, and investment operations. The solution offers a fully integrated front-to-back architecture that is scalable, cloud-ready, and supports both on-premises deployment and low-code customization, and omni-channel banking. It includes built-in regulatory compliance features, real-time processing capabilities, and has been implemented across financial institutions in more than 36 countries. iMAL enables Islamic banks to improve operational efficiency, ensure Shari’ah compliance, and deliver consistent and ethical financial services.
eMACH.ai Core Banking platform by Intellect Consumer Banking (iGCB) is an integrated, cloud-native, microservices-based, API-first, AI-enabled solution designed to modernize the core banking systems of Retail, Central, SME, & Commercial banks. Built on a composable, headless, & event-driven architecture, it delivers agility, scalability, and resilience—capable of handling billions of transactions & millions of accounts globally. It offers a comprehensive suite across Core Operations, Treasury, Lending, Cards, Payments, Digital Engagement, and Trade Finance, powered by 386 microservices and 2015 APIs. The platform’s low-code/no-code process designer empowers institutions to configure and launch their own signature bank experience, supporting phased modernization & continuous innovation. Through embedded AI, automation, and open finance capabilities, it enhances interoperability, speed product launches, ensure compliance, & lower total cost of ownership.
DNA is a core banking software designed to support financial institutions in managing transactions, accounts, and customer information. The software provides functionalities for processing deposits, loans, and payments while enabling real-time data access for account management and reporting. DNA features tools for workflow automation, customizable modules, and integration capabilities with third-party and ancillary banking applications. It addresses business requirements related to regulatory compliance, operational efficiency, and digital banking by offering centralized control and scalability across multiple banking channels. The software facilitates seamless account servicing and improves the management of customer relationships through configurable user interfaces and robust security features.
Mambu Cloud Banking Platform is a software designed to support the creation, management, and delivery of banking products and services through a cloud-native architecture. The software enables financial institutions to configure and launch products such as loans, deposits, and current accounts, with workflow automation, compliance features, and integration capabilities. It addresses the need for flexible and scalable banking operations by providing APIs and component-based architecture to facilitate digital transformation, product innovation, and integration with third-party solutions. Mambu Cloud Banking Platform supports a range of use cases including retail and business banking, lending, and fintech implementations, helping organizations adapt to evolving market demands and regulatory requirements.
FIS Profile is a core banking software designed to support a broad range of banking operations including account management, transaction processing, payments, and loan servicing. The software offers real-time processing capabilities and is structured to help financial institutions manage retail and commercial banking products while ensuring compliance with regulatory requirements. FIS Profile provides automation of routine banking processes, centralized data management, and integrated workflows to assist in reducing operational risk and increasing operational efficiency. The software supports scalability to accommodate growth and changing business needs, allowing institutions to adapt to new financial products and delivery channels. It addresses business challenges related to transaction integrity, regulatory compliance, and operational efficiency within core banking environments.
ICBS is a software designed for financial institutions, offering functionalities that support core banking operations such as customer account management, transaction processing, and loan administration. The software facilitates activities including deposits, withdrawals, transfers, payment processing, and regulatory compliance. ICBS integrates modules to address retail, corporate, and Islamic banking requirements and includes tools for risk management and reporting. The software aims to streamline banking workflows and reduce manual errors, enabling institutions to standardize procedures and enhance operational oversight. By providing a centralized platform for banking processes, ICBS seeks to improve efficiency in managing customer information and financial products, supporting institutions in meeting organizational and regulatory needs.
SAP Transactional Banking is a software designed to support banks in managing core banking processes such as payments, deposits, and accounts. The software offers capabilities for product management, transaction processing, and account maintenance, enabling banks to efficiently handle large volumes of customer transactions. It provides tools for automating workflow, reducing manual intervention, and ensuring regulatory compliance across banking operations. SAP Transactional Banking integrates with digital channels, allowing real-time updates and multi-channel service delivery. By centralizing transactional data and streamlining banking processes, the software helps organizations address the challenges of operational efficiency, risk management, and evolving customer expectations in the financial sector.
Avaloq Platform is a software designed for financial institutions to streamline core banking operations and wealth management processes. The software enables banks and wealth managers to automate workflows across account management, payments, securities trading, portfolio management and client onboarding. Avaloq Platform supports regulatory compliance, data management and reporting requirements, while enabling integration with third-party systems. Its functionality aims to enhance operational efficiency, optimize client servicing and facilitate the delivery of digital financial products. The software provides features that address scalability, security and customization needs for financial organizations, helping to manage complex banking and investment activities within a unified system.
SilverLake System is a software developed to support banking operations by offering functionalities for core processing, account management, transaction handling, and regulatory compliance. The software is designed to automate daily workflows and enable financial institutions to manage deposits, loans, customer information, and reporting tasks. SilverLake System assists institutions in addressing efficiency, accuracy, and security challenges associated with traditional banking processes. It integrates with ancillary modules that support various banking services, allowing customization based on institutional needs and regulatory standards. The software is utilized to facilitate operational consistency and provide tools for data management and analytics in a banking environment.
Fiserv Signature is a core banking software designed to streamline banking operations for financial institutions. The software provides functionalities for account management, transaction processing, loan servicing, and customer relationship management. It supports retail and commercial banking requirements, including deposit processing, payments, loans, and branch operations. Signature enables institutions to automate workflows, enhance regulatory compliance, and improve operational efficiency by integrating various banking functions into a centralized platform. This software is used to facilitate secure data management, support digital channels, and deliver a consistent experience across multiple products and services. It addresses the business need for a scalable and flexible system capable of adapting to evolving banking requirements and regulations.
Vault Core is a software developed by Thought Machine designed for banks and financial institutions to manage core banking operations. The software features a cloud-native architecture and provides support for real-time transaction processing, product configuration, and account management. Vault Core enables institutions to design, launch, and modify financial products such as savings, loans, and current accounts without reliance on legacy systems. The software addresses business challenges related to operational efficiency and scalability by offering automation capabilities, customizable workflows, and integration with digital channels. Vault Core aims to streamline legacy system replacement and facilitates compliance with regulatory requirements through a flexible and extensible system architecture.
Intellect Global Transaction Banking software is designed to support transaction banking operations for financial institutions by providing solutions for cash management, payments, liquidity, trade finance, virtual accounts, and supply chain finance. The software enables banks to manage corporate and institutional banking functions, streamline workflows, and automate transaction processing across multiple products and channels. It addresses business problems such as fragmented banking processes, manual intervention, and lack of real-time visibility, helping organizations to improve operational efficiency, enhance compliance, and deliver integrated transaction banking services through a unified platform.
Essence is a banking software designed to support core banking operations for financial institutions. The software provides functionality for account management, payment processing, lending, deposit handling, and customer information management. Essence enables financial institutions to automate routine transactions and streamline workflows, supporting regulatory compliance and integration with digital channels such as mobile and online banking. The software addresses the business challenges of operating diverse banking services efficiently by providing centralized data management, facilitating reporting tools, and enabling open APIs for connectivity with third-party applications. Essence supports banks in managing financial products, handling customer onboarding, and delivering banking services through a flexible and scalable platform.
Oracle Banking Platform is software designed to support banks in streamlining core banking operations and digital transformation. The software provides functionalities for customer onboarding, account management, payments processing, loan origination, and compliance monitoring. Oracle Banking Platform enables financial institutions to integrate with external systems, automate workflows, and deliver services across multiple channels to improve operational efficiency and regulatory compliance. The software addresses banking needs such as scalability for transaction volumes, product customization, and secure data management, facilitating modernization and adaptation to evolving industry requirements.
Promosoft Financial Suite is a software designed to support the management of financial operations for banks and financial institutions. The software provides modules for accounting, payments processing, settlements, and reconciliation. It automates routine financial tasks, offering functionalities for transaction management, general ledger operations, and financial reporting. Promosoft Financial Suite aims to address the challenges of operational efficiency and compliance by providing configurable workflows and integrating with various banking systems. The software is structured to help organizations maintain accurate financial records, streamline back-office processes, and support regulatory requirements in financial management.
Fusion Phoenix is a software designed to support core banking needs for financial institutions. The software offers functionalities such as account management, deposit processing, loan origination, and transaction management. It aims to help organizations streamline operations, manage compliance requirements, and maintain customer and account data in a secure environment. Fusion Phoenix includes tools for reporting, workflow automation, and integration with other financial technology systems, addressing business needs for efficiency, accuracy, and regulatory adherence within banking environments.














